12-Step Worksheet with Questions A Guide to Working the 12 Steps To a newcomer, a 12-step program can be overwhelming. You may look at dramatic concepts such as making amends or reaching a spiritual awakening and wonder what that means in practical terms. Your first source for the substantive content of each step should be your sponsor.

Worksheet for Step 12 of 12 Step Programs Step 12 Focus of step 12: This step and the corresponding questions address the need to pass on the tremendous benefits you have derived from recovery to others. As the Big Book tells us to do, these questions will help us practice the principles we have learned in all of our affairs. Step 12 Questions
